Firstly in Canada, we use red/orange flags, and we don't care if it's sticking out or shown.

2. Our field is considerable larger, and many of our fouls are enforced at the point the ball was held, not the point of the foul, so you may have a foul in your area, but the ball is clearly somewhere else, and you need to pick up that spot.

3. I use the torpedo flag on all games except mud games. I'm gonna have to get a new one for the upcoming year because it's lost it's new flag look, although i thought it'd last more than a year.

Just some explanations.

When I thow my flag it's either high in the air, or to a specific spot. If there's no weight, it won't go that high, and I'll have a harder time aiming for that spot.
